What you’ll be doing The role primarily supports the following teams: Chinese Art, Classical Indian Art and Contemporary Indian Art. What your day might look like Administrative Support To support the Department Coordinator and Specialists in logistical and administrative functions relating to the Department Helping to receipt consignments Local property coordination for auctions and private sales Assist in setting up and maintaining exhibitions and boardroom events Assiting the Department Coordinator to maintain property trackers with all incoming property information Arrange local collections for property located in the UK Assist the Department Coordinator by liaising with shipping department to obtain shipping quotes and apply for export licenses to France, Hong Kong or New York, licenses for value and CITES Assist the Department Coordinator in London to ensure the works are shipped for prompt arrival in their sale sites in Paris, New York, and Hong Kong Assist the Specialists in the preparation of valuations and catalogues Research archives for past auction prices Liaise with the Photography and Image editing teams to ensure property is photographed ahead of deadlines Competitor’s Sales (UK) Keeping a record of competitor’s sale dates and checking catalogues received prior to the sale Marking catalogues with prices realised and tallying the results Advising the Business Manager of results Miscellaneous Any other tasks required as and when they arise What you’ll bring to the team History of Art Graduate (or other relevant degree) Previous work experience – either paid or voluntary – within the Art Sector Language skills (fluent in English plus one or two other languages, especially European or Asian languages) Self-motivated and highly-organised Ability to demonstrate client facing experience Strong IT skills with familiarity of all Microsoft packages.
